A great song by the great Canadian Bryan Adams, from his new album 11. First tune your guitar down a half step to match the recording Most of the Song is just the same pattern repeated over and over again:
  D        G        C        G
e:-----------------:-----------------:
b:-----3-------3---:-----3------3----:
g:---2-------0---0-:---0------0---0--:
d:-0---------------:-----------------:
a:-----------------:-3---------------:
e:--------3--------:-------3---------:
But then there's a bridge
   Am                  Am        C
e:-------------------:----------------------------:
b:-------1--------1--:-------1----------1-------1-:
g:---2---------2-----:----2---------0---------0---:
d:-----2---------2---:------2---------2-----2-----:
a:-0--------0--------:--0------2--3-------3-------:
e:-------------------:----------------------------:
And after the bridge the main riff changes a bit: D G C G
e:-----------------:-----------------:
b:-----3-----------:-----3------3----:
g:---2-------------:---0------0---0--:
d:-0---------------:-----------------:
a:-----------------:-3---------------:
e:--------3--------:-------3---------:
